2:04.0 | As we dive into today's important podcast episode because one of the most difficult parts of going |
2:13.9 | from anxiety to inner peace is letting go of the perceived benefits |
2:20.8 | of holding on to increased fear. |
2:24.9 | Because for so many anxiety suffers, |
2:29.1 | fear doesn't just feel like a response. |
2:33.0 | It feels like a strategy, a necessary tool for survival. |
